Extended Description
MUL64 definitely needs its own scheduler class, possibly the others as well. Multiply by constant (IMUL32rmi etc.) may need splitting off as well.
Note: Integer multiplies seem to be a common issue in vectorization regressions (incorrectly comparing scalar/vector integer multiply costs), so all need to be accurate for [Bug #36550] to work well.
